묻고답하기
page_full_width" class="col-xs-12" |cond="$__Context->page_full_width">
회원그룹별로 다른목록을 출력하고싶습니다.
2013.03.17 15:05
예전에 물어서 답변 받은내용입니다.
<script type="text/javascript" cond="$mid=='특정페이지mid명'&&$logged_info->group_list[그룹번호]">
location.href="{getUrl('mid','보여줄페이지mid명')}";
</script>
비회원과 준회원은 a.htm란 페이지를 보여주고
선택한회원그룹은 b.htm 페이지를 보여주려고합니다.
<script type="text/javascript" cond="$mid=='특정페이지mid명'&&$logged_info->group_list[150188,1,121,1879871]">
location.href="http://a.htm";
</script>
1.위처럼했는데 특정회원그룹은 특정mid말고 b.htm을 보여주고싶은데 어떻게해야될까요?
2.그리고 특정페이지에 mid를지정해도 무조건 a.htm만 나옵니다... 왜그럴까요??
$logged_info->group_list[150188,1,121,1879871]
어디서 이렇게 하라고 했는지 모르겠지만 (아마도 혼자 만든 것으로 생각 되지만)
이것은 잘못된 겁니다.
복수의 그룹은
$logged_info->group_list[1]||$logged_info->group_list[2]
이런 식으로 해야 합니다.
아니면 그룹번호를 배열로 정의해두고
in_array(검색할 그룹번호, 정의된그룹배열)
이런 방식으로 비교해야 합니다........
도움이 되었길.......
참고
사용하는 상황에 따라 || 아니면 && 이것을 사용해야 합니다.......